Friends of Music Alley

The Friends of Music Alley 501(c)(3) is a non-profit organization that raises funds for the purpose of making high-quality live music events and the arts accessible to the Bridgewater, Massachusetts and surrounding communities.

The Friends of Music Alley (FoMA) prioritizes supporting original musicians from the region in an effort to help bolster the local artist community. FoMA makes these high-quality live music experiences accessible in a couple different ways. Our flagship Thursday evening Summer Concert Series that is hosted at Black Hat Brew Works brings musicians into Bridgewater for amazing performances during the summer months. FoMA also sponsors our Music Alley Open Mic Night in our beautiful Central Square alley venue twice per month on Tuesday evenings June through August. SUMMER CONCERT SERIES

The Friends of Music Alley hosts their annual Summer Concert Series each Thursday evening between late June and the end of August. All shows are FREE and open to the public. All ages are welcome to come enjoy the concerts.

These shows are hosted at Black Hat Brew Works (25 Scotland Blvd., Bridgewater, MA 02324) rain or shine. Doors open at 5:00 pm and the opening act begins at 5:30 pm, with the featured act then performing 6:30 - 8:00 pm. The show moves into Black Hat’s spacious taproom in the case of rain. Various food trucks and vendors are often on site.

MUsic Alley Open Mic

The Friends of Music Alley 501(c)(3) has partnered with Kim Hill’s Mix N’ Music to host Open Mic events in the Music Alley venue located at 50 Central Square, Bridgewater, MA. These Open Mic events are free and open to anyone that would like to perform or come enjoy the music.

Open Mic events occur the first and third Tuesday each Month starting in June and running through early September. Please follow Music Alley’s social media for updates on Open Mic date specifics.

THE OPENING ACT

The Opening Act is a talent evaluation event hosted by the Friends of Music Alley 501(c)(3). The event was created as an opportunity to give local musicians the opportunity to perform in front of FoMA board members for consideration for the 2026 summer concert series.

The event drew musicians from all over Southeastern, Massachusetts. Performers were able to play on a stage with full sound production in front of judges, supportive fans, and a community of fellow musicians.

Winners earned compensated opening or feature bookings in the 2026 Music Alley summer concert series. All performers were able to network and be seen by judges with professional experience in radio, talent buying, and music.
